Slice-prompted HR-CTV interactive segmentation for cervical cancer brachytherapy: A multi-center study.

BACKGROUND: In computed tomography (CT)-guided cervical cancer brachytherapy, the manual contouring for the high-risk clinical target volume (HR-CTV) is a time-consuming and expertise-dependent process. Furthermore, automated approaches struggle with ambiguous boundaries of HR-CTV.
